Ok, after watching all the preview videos and with the help of the script and some of your posts I've made the list of (almost) all levels of RL:
[Teensies in Trouble:
Once upon a Time
Once upon a Time - Invaded
Creepy Castle
Enchanted Forest
Barbara Level
Ropes Course
Quick Sand
Elysia Level
How to Shoot your Dragon
Breathing Fire!
Castle Rock
Toad Story:
Ray and the Beanstalk
Ray and the Beanstalk - Invaded
The Winds of Strange
Aurora Level
Castle in the Clouds
Altitude Quickness
Twila Level
When Toads Fly
Armored Toad!
Orchestral Chaos
Fiesta de los Muertos:
What the Duck?
What the Duck? - Invaded
Spoiled Rotten
Estelia Level
I've Got a Filling
Snakes on a Cake
Selena Level
Lucha Libre Get Away
Wrestling with a Giant!
Mariachi Madness
20,000 Lums Under the Sea:
The Mysterious Inflatable Island
The Deadly Lights
Ursula Level
Mansion of the Deep
Mansion of the Deep - Invaded
Infiltration Station
Emma Level
Elevator Ambush
There's Always a Bigger Fish
A Madman's Creation!
Gloo Gloo
Olympus Maximus:
Shields Up... and Down
Shields Up... and Down - Invaded
The Dark Creatures Rise
Olympia Level
The Amazing Maze
The Great Lava Pursuit
Sibylla Level
Swarmed and Dangerous
Hell Breaks Loose
A Cloud of Darkness!
Dragon Slayer
Living Dead Party:
Grannies World Tour
Jibberish Jungle:
Geyser Blast
Swinging Caves
Hi-Ho Moskito!
Climb Out
Still Flowing
Hunter Gatherer
Playing in the Shade
Poor Little Daisy
Desert of Dijiridoos:
Best Original Score
Skyward Sonata
Shooting Me Softly
Tricky Winds
Snake Eyes
Don't Shoot the DJ
Tuned-Up Treasure
To Bubblize a Mocking Bird
Gourmand Land:
Dashing Through the Snow
Piping Hot!
Aim for the Eel!
Dragon Soup
Fickle Fruit
You're on Fire!
Ice-Fishing Folly
My Heartburn's for You
Sea of Serendipity:
Swimming with the Stars
Freaking Flipper
Fire When Wetty
Why So Crabby?
Beware of the Mini Murray
Scuba Shootout
Risky Ruin
Murray of the Deep
Mystical Pique:
Mystical Munkeys
Golly G. Golem
Riding the Storm
On Top of Old Smokey
Mecha No Mistake!
Shoot for the Stars
Tricky Temple Too
Unknown, probably The Reveal]
The levels not included are: [the invasion mode levels, Living Dead Party levels and the minigames (there also could be some secret ones like the 8-bit version of all the music stages).]
